揭秘动态网站源码:构建个性化网络世界的秘密武器
随着互联网技术的飞速发展,网站已经成为人们获取信息、交流互动的重要平台。而在这其中,动态网站源码扮演着至关重要的角色。本文将带您深入了解动态网站源码,揭示其背后的秘密,帮助您构建属于自己的个性化网络世界。
一、什么是动态网站源码?
动态网站源码,顾名思义,是指能够根据用户请求和数据库信息动态生成网页内容的网站源代码。与静态网站相比,动态网站具有更好的交互性和可扩展性,能够满足用户对个性化、实时信息的需求。
动态网站源码通常由以下几部分组成:
1.前端代码:主要包括HTML、CSS和JavaScript等,负责展示网站界面和用户交互。
2.后端代码:主要包括服务器端脚本语言(如PHP、Java、Python等)和数据库操作代码,负责处理用户请求、业务逻辑和与数据库的交互。
3.数据库:存储网站的数据,如用户信息、产品信息、文章内容等。
二、动态网站源码的优势
1.个性化:动态网站可以根据用户的需求和偏好,实时生成个性化的网页内容,提升用户体验。
2.可扩展性:动态网站可以通过修改后端代码和数据库结构,方便地增加新的功能模块,满足不断变化的需求。
3.易于维护:动态网站采用模块化设计,便于管理和维护,降低开发成本。
4.安全性:动态网站可以通过后端代码对用户输入进行过滤和验证,有效防止SQL注入、XSS攻击等安全问题。
三、动态网站源码的常见技术
1.PHP:PHP是一种广泛使用的服务器端脚本语言,具有丰富的函数库和良好的兼容性,适合构建中小型动态网站。
2.Java:Java是一种面向对象的编程语言,具有良好的跨平台性,适合构建大型企业级动态网站。
3.Python:Python是一种简洁易学的编程语言,具有强大的数据处理能力和丰富的第三方库,适合快速开发动态网站。
4.Ruby:Ruby是一种优雅的编程语言,拥有强大的Web框架,如Ruby on Rails,适合快速开发大型动态网站。
5.ASP.NET:ASP.NET是微软推出的一种Web开发框架,具有良好的兼容性和安全性,适合构建Windows平台上的动态网站。
四、如何获取动态网站源码?
1.商业购买:许多网站开发公司提供现成的动态网站源码,用户可以根据自己的需求选择合适的源码。
2.开源社区:GitHub、码云等开源社区提供了大量的免费动态网站源码,用户可以下载并根据自己的需求进行修改。
3.自行开发:具备一定编程基础的用户可以自行开发动态网站源码,以满足个性化需求。
总结:
动态网站源码是构建个性化网络世界的秘密武器。通过深入了解动态网站源码,我们可以更好地把握网站开发趋势,提高网站质量和用户体验。在今后的网站开发过程中,让我们共同努力,打造更多优秀的动态网站。